I'm having no luck finding a steering column with a column shifter, So I am thinking about converting it to a floor shifter.

 

How hard is it to do?

Posted

It's much easier than going the other way. You can get a shifter from any XJ (Cherokee). Keep in mind that different engine/tranny/transfer case combinations use different length control rods under the floor, so ideally you should get the parts from an XJ that has the same engine, tranny and transfer case as your MJ. The floor pan of your truck is already set up with the mounting points, just bolt the pieces in and go.

JohnQ,

 

Keep in mind that the column shif automatic has a different bench seat from the floor shift automatic. At least my 91 Comanche with column shift has a full bench seat, without any "notch" on the bench.

 

Does anyone know where Jeep sourced the steering column from? That could give you a whole list of different vehicles to look at for a column shift, besides just a Comanche.

 

I am thinking that certain GM products may have the steering column you need. But have no clue as to which products that might be.
